The Steve Costanzo Story

Steve Costanzo is in his third season as the Husky head wrestling coach.  He is the 13th coach in the history of the St. Cloud State University wrestling program, which dates back to 1949-50.    
 
Costanzo begins his 10th season overall as a head coach.  He has an overall record of 78-39-2 while coaching 82 National Qualifiers, 34 All-Americans and 2 National Champions.
 
Last season, Costanzo’s Huskies finished their campaign with a 13-2 mark.  This was most wins produced by the Huskies in a season since 1972-73. The Huskies also advanced seven wrestlers to the NCAA championships and they saw three of those grapplers earn All-America stats (Brad Padgett, Nick Wilkes and John Sundgren). At the NCAA Division II championships, SCSU placed 12th as a team and it was ranked among the nation's top 10 squads in the Division II polls in 2007-08. In his first year with the Huskies in 2006-07, Costanzo charted a 4-7 record. His career record at SCSU now stands at 17-9 overall.    

2008-09 will mark Costanzo's debut in the Northern Sun Intercollegate Conference.  
 
In 2006, Costanzo led Dana College to the NAIA National Championship (with a tourney record 193 points) and a NWCA National Duals Championships.  His squads while at Dana College won Great Plains Athletic Conference titles in 2003, 2004, 2005 and 2006, and they won Regional Championships in 2001, 2002, 2005 and 2006.  The Vikings finished with top 10 finishes at the NAIA National Championships in 2004, 2005 and 2006.
 
Costanzo’s recruiting squads while at Dana College, recognized by Wrestling USA Magazine, finished 15th in 2001, 4th in 2004 and 1st in 2005 for non-NCAA Division I programs.  Costanzo’s 2006 SCSU class recorded the tenth spot in that same publication for non-NCAA Division I programs.  This past summer, Costanzo’s coaching staff was recognized by Intermat as having one of the top NCAA Division II recruiting classes for 2007.
 
Costanzo received the NWCA and NAIA Coach of the Year awards in 2006, and gained NAIA Regional Coach of the Year accolades in 2005 and 2006.  In 2005, Costanzo served as the NWCA All-Star team coach at Oklahoma State University.  In addition, he was credited with the 2003 NAIA Robert Bubb Coaching Excellence award which epitomizes the qualities and characteristics of a role model and mentor for developing young student-athletes.
 
A 1996 graduate of the University of Nebraska-Omaha, Costanzo was a three-time All-American wrestler for the Mavericks from 1993-1995.  He was inducted into the Nebraska Wrestling Hall of Fame in 2006 and still ranks as high as fifth on UNO’s all-time wrestling win list with 133 victories as a collegiate wrestler.  In 1994 and 1995, Costanzo earned NCC champion honors and he served as a team captain at UNO in 1995.  Costanzo was also named the Nebraska Collegiate Wrestler of the Year in 1994.
 
Costanzo earned his Bachelor’s degree in physical Education from UNO in 1996.  He is currently pursuing his Masters Degree through Emporia State University studying physical education. He and his wife Nancy have four children: Cassandra, Sam, Katie and Brock.
